No engine light. Gem codes. I purchased this 98 ranger 5 months ago and it's had problems for near 3 months. I've had it looked to be told the iac was bad so they replaced it to no avail. Missed shifts, delayed shifts, has a real hard time going into first on downshift and never does once I've drove for near 20 minutes and sometimes does it when cold it doesn't like overdrive so 50 on the highway is all she has. When it isn't down shifting the brakes become very weak and won't slow down till it downshifts if it does. Speedometer freaks out and loses calibration, wipers cut on and off, door ajar light and dome light stay on to long, 4x4 low issues. Vacuum hubs were taken off and replaced with mile marker manual locking hubs, Hella lights wired, every fluid was changed at 155k including trans and tcase it has 166k now. I've replaced rear abs speed sensor, crank shaft position sensor, cleaned maf, cleaned throttle plate, cleaned various electrical connectors, including tcase relay module. Replaced Iac pigtail connector. I pulled the gem and it has 2009 stamped on it so it's been replaced once before. It looked clean and corrosion free as did all the connectors and wires behind the radio. Is the gem bad? One shop said Iac the other said transmission and one told me torque converter. Any help would be appreciated. After three shops I'm getting impatient. They all disregard the codes it has and blame it on the 33's
